Behavioral Science is the 146th most popular major in the country with 3,469 degrees awarded in 2019-2020. In 2017-2018, behavioral science graduates who were awarded their degree in 2015-2017, earned an average of $29,550 and had an average of $39,821 in loans still to pay off.
Across the Southwest region, there were 1,207 behavioral science graduates with average earnings and debt of $28,129 and $33,516 respectively. At the bachelor’s degree level specifically, there were 644 behavioral science graduates with average earnings and debt of $38,896 and $23,899 respectively.

You’ll be in good company if you decide to attend University of Phoenix - Arizona. It ranked #1 on our 2022 Best Value Behavioral Science Schools for a Bachelor’s in the Southwest Region list. UOPX - Arizona is located in Tempe, Arizona and, has a large student population. In 2019-2020, this school awarded 595 bachelors’s behavioral science degrees to qualified students.
UOPX - Arizona also made our “Best Behavioral Science Bachelor’s Degree Schools in the Southwest Region” list, coming in at #1. The yearly cost to attend UOPX - Arizona is $12,944 for southwest region bachelor’s degree behavioral science students.

You’ll be in good company if you decide to attend University of Phoenix - Texas. It ranked #2 on our 2022 Best Value Behavioral Science Schools for a Bachelor’s in the Southwest Region list. University of Phoenix - Texas is a small private for-profit school situated in Houston, Texas. It awarded 2 bachelors’s behavioral science degrees in 2019-2020.
UOPX - Texas did well in our major quality rankings, too. It placed #4 on our “Best Behavioral Science Bachelor’s Degree Schools in the Southwest Region” list. The estimated yearly cost for University of Phoenix - Texas is $12,237 for southwest region bachelor’s degree behavioral science students.
Since the school has a student-to-faculty ratio of 8 to 1, those pursuing a degree will have more opportunities to interact with their professors.
Out of the 4 schools in the Best Value Behavioral Science Schools for a Bachelor’s in the Southwest Region that were part of this year’s ranking, University of Houston - Clear Lake landed the #3 spot on the list. Houston, Texas is the setting for this medium-sized institution of higher learning. The public school handed out bachelors’s behavioral science degrees to 45 students in 2019-2020.
UH Clear Lake not only placed well in this ranking. It is also #2 on our “Best Behavioral Science Bachelor’s Degree Schools in the Southwest Region” list. The estimated yearly cost for University of Houston - Clear Lake is $10,612 for Southwest Region Bachelor’s Degree Behavioral Science students.

You’ll join some of the best and brightest minds around if you attend East Texas Baptist University. The school came in at #4 for the Best Value Behavioral Science Schools for a Bachelor’s in the Southwest Region. East Texas Baptist University is a small school located in Marshall, Texas that handed out 2 bachelors’s behavioral science degrees in 2019-2020.
East Texas Baptist University did well in our major quality rankings, too. It placed #3 on our “Best Behavioral Science Bachelor’s Degree Schools in the Southwest Region” list. It costs about $22,515 for southwest region bachelor’s degree behavioral science students per year to attend East Texas Baptist University.
